So I'm just getting into BP shooting. I've got a flintlock Kentucky rifle on the way, so today I decided to locate some black powder locally.
Well it wasn't so easy. I had already gone to my local gun stores and only one of those had any powder at all and it wasn't black powder.
There is a range nearby that I know has lanes set aside for black powder and has a proshop in it. I thought for sure they would carry Goex, but NO only the substitute black powder. (I've already been warned away from using that in a flintlock).
So finally I did a search online and found an old thread here that had a link to Graff & Sons. https://www.grafs.com/retail/catalog/vendor/vendorId/39
They had the 3F Goex that I wanted in stock but of course there is a 25 buck hazmat fee. So I bought 3 pounds from them because the hazmat fee was the same.
That should last me a while.
Pretty good site. It has a lot of things someone who is just getting into BP shooting needs and their prices seem pretty good. The Goex 3F was $15 a can, which seemed pretty good. However, with the hazmat and shipping fee it ended up being about 25 buck a can. Not cheap, but better than not having any powder.
